New paper (and one I reviewed!): The Saimaa ringed seal from freshwater Lake Saimaa in Finland has a relatively old divergence from other ringed seals and is morphologically distinct - and represents its own species, Pusa saimensis. Loytynoja et al.: www.pnas.org/doi/epub/10....

CONFIRMED: Discovery of human footprints in alluvium dated to the Last Glacial Maximum (LGM) at White Sands, New Mexico…spans >23.6 thousand years to ~17.0 thousand calibrated years before present, providing another line of evidence further supporting the validity of an LGM age for the tracks.

Another new horseshoe crab, this time the first known Silurian species, filling a 63 million year gap in the horseshoe crab fossil record. This specimen was actually found by Sam Ciurca 50 years ago - another example of the importance of museum collections! ⚒️🧪 doi.org/10.1098/rspb...

That old idea where glyptodonts are the cousins to ALL #armadillos? Nope. It was mostly overlooked until recently, but armadillo experts have been pushing the idea that glyptodonts are nested _within_ armadillos since at least 2006.
